Latest Patents
One of Takada's most noteworthy inventions is related to an exposure method and pattern data preparation system that enhances the reliability of selective pattern exposure. The technology employs an electron beam as a focused beam, allowing for the efficient preparation of pattern data and robust inspection of aperture patterns. His inventive pattern exposure apparatus operates through a batch transfer system that can manage both repeated and non-repeated patterns across various semiconductor graphics. This sophisticated mechanism includes an EB drawing section, a control I/O section, a drawing control section, and a data storage section, all finely tuned for optimal performance in the semiconductor manufacturing process.
